    The cube is a menu of items that can be cubed. If it's not on the menu then it can't be cubed. For example a Stone of Jordan is not on the menu. This is because it doesn't have a legendary power. As powerful as it is, there is no Orange text to extract.


    After you extract an item, the menu un-greys the item as an equippable passive skill. Follower items are not on the menu.

    Your Marauder is lacking a bunch of things. You should have Sentry Damage on your shoulders and chest. You shouldn't need Vengeance as the cooldown is forever and stacking CDR over RCR is not advised. You should be using a generator along with picking up health globes and bat companion should be on constant cooldown because you want the wolf howl up as much as possible. You quiver should have a skill damage bonus. Most people go with Cluster Arrow with Marauders over MS. Cluster Arrow will shoot farther and thus yield more damage from the ones you leave behind. It shoots at least 2.5 screens if walls don't get in the way. Tumble is more expensive that Trail of Cinders with 28% Fire RCR on the Cindercoat. I question even using the Cindercoat to begin with. Focus and Restraint is too strong. But if you are going to use RRoG, farm a better one. Yours is horrible. Ancient Jewelry means nothing as a really good one will not have Main Stat. In the case of Rings you want both crits and either weapon damage or RCR. Amulets should have Elemental, CHC, CHD and Socket. If you had a Hellfire, I could understand not having the elemental because a good passive is better than Elemental. The rings you can get I would go double Unity if I chose to equip RRoG. Compass Rose is only good if you have the complimentary Necklace. Roll IAS off your gloves to RCR. Marauders does not need Attack Speed, you've rolled it on your gloves and belt. The make absolutely no sense, since you aren't even generating. Evasive Fire Focus generates the most Hatred. The Diamond in your helm is correct. That CDR will help bring up your wolf howl and speed up the recharge on your sentries. CHC is really low because you don't have it on your RRoG and Helm. And considering you have Witching Hour, you CHD is also low.

    OP, you are cubing Unity on all your build. That makes no sense. Unity does have the Legendary Affix but it also rolls with Elite Damage. In the case of Convention of Elements, if we eliminate the Legendary Affix CoE only has the advantage that it rolls with Socket. You should wear Unity. In the case of Bastions of Will, because it is a ring set, cubing Unity is reasonable. SoJ is well paired with Unity because it also rolls with Elemental and Elite. These are double buff rings. Not actually wearing them is bad itemization.
